Output f72e218f0b8e4404cd80866e3e3d36ac77dfd631320edab7d9092b4b64fc8b69:141

value
41037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ba2c85baefa33461c93bb7c080bc7f91fdeca3f5 OP_EQUAL
address
3JfQwhBjJNbQvyu5BgA16J7jbeNRVYZ14f
transaction
f72e218f0b8e4404cd80866e3e3d36ac77dfd631320edab7d9092b4b64fc8b69
confirmations
205942
spent
true